Transaction 4d00969c074ffa40bf05c5639eba3a81f91168fa4594dcf3c345c0e1f6806fac

6 Input
2 Outputs
  • 4d00969c074ffa40bf05c5639eba3a81f91168fa4594dcf3c345c0e1f6806fac:0
  • value  42575000
    address  1EH4qmEC5U2qEH1XTsrXFape2B8EkMxxgS
  • 4d00969c074ffa40bf05c5639eba3a81f91168fa4594dcf3c345c0e1f6806fac:1
  • value  604000000
    address  33PaJAtE7QhharP1AoV4jsENZPvLsMHYUz